With our default coverage, any items lost or damaged during the move will be compensated for a value of $0.30 per pound per article. For example, if an item weighing 20 lbs. were lost or damaged, New City would owe you $6.00 to help pay for these damages. Just for a reference, most 43” HD TVs are about 20 lbs. (20 lbs x .30 cents = $6.00)

Jul 29, 2022 · Moving companies offer various insurance options, two of which are mandated by federal law for interstate moves. Here are a few types: Released value coverage (or basic carrier liability) - As the most basic coverage required by federal law, this liability coverage is free and based on weight, paying up to 60 cents per pound for an item. What to... In insurance terms, the 'third party' refers to the person who has incurred a loss or damage because of your actions. They then lodge a claim against you, the first party (the insured person who caused the accident). The insurance company which ultimately settles the claim is the second party. SLI protects the renter and any listed authorized drivers against claims made by a third party for bodily and/or property damage sustained as a result of an accident while you are operating your Penske truck. This coverage is excess over the underlying insurance specified within your signed rental agreement up to $1,000,000.
